Rainer Mager wrote:

> > Would this be an SMP IA32 box with glibc 2.2? I have two such boxen
> > showing exactly the same behaviour, although I can't reproduce it at will.
>
> Close, it is actually an SMP IA32 box with glibc 2.1.3. But you've now
> convinced me to not upgrade glibc yet  ;-)

Upgrade -past- 2.2, get 2.2.1.  2.2 causes numerous segfaults, notably sendmail
and apache stop working.
